Specification
| Power (KW) | 350 |
|---|---|
| Power (HP) | 469 |
| Torque (Nm) | 2003 |
| Power (PS) | 476 |
| ECU Brand | Bosch |
| ECU Version | MD1CE101 |
| ECU Micro | TC299 |
| Tools | KESS3 compatible Powergate not compatible |
| Connection | OBD available |
| Year | 2021 |
| Type | Tractors |
